Tongluo Shenggu is a traditional Chinese medicine (TCM) formulation primarily available as an oral capsule. It is used clinically for the treatment of glucocorticoid-induced osteonecrosis of the femoral head (GIONFH) and other orthopedic conditions. The formulation consists mainly of water extracts from pigeon pea leaves and may include other herbal ingredients such as Rhizoma Drynariae, Herba Sarcandrae, and Radix Notoginseng[6][4][3]. Its mechanism centers on promoting angiogenesis by upregulating the VEGF-VEGFR2-PKC-Raf-1-MEK-ERK signaling pathway, which helps ameliorate vascular damage associated with osteonecrosis. Additional pharmacological actions include anti-inflammatory and analgesic effects[6][4]. The product has been in clinical use in China for several years.
